Royal Enfield Guerrilla 450— Royal Enfield, a company famous for premium motorcycles in the Indian automobile market, has increased the prices of its popular 450 cc segment bike Royal Enfield Guerrilla 450. This increase in prices made by the company has been implemented with immediate effect. Increase of up to ₹ 2,044 depending on the variant
According to official reports, the manufacturer has increased the prices of this bike by Rs 1,869 to Rs 2,044 depending on the variant. The company has not disclosed any specific reason behind this price increase. However, apart from the change in price, there have been no mechanical changes in the design, features or technical specifications of the motorcycle. This bike will be available with the same capacity and features as before.
How much did the price of which variant increase?
Here is the complete list of price hikes applicable to different color variants of the Royal Enfield Guerrilla 450:
- Apex Red and Twilight Blue: The price of both these base variants has been increased by ₹ 1,869.
- Apex Green: The price of this variant has been increased by ₹ 1,922.
- Shadow Ash, Pein Bronze and Smoke Silver: The company has implemented an increase of ₹ 2,003 on these medium variants.
- Brava Blue: This top-end variant has seen the highest price increase from ₹2,004 to ₹2,044.
After this modification, the new ex-showroom price of the starting variant of Guerrilla 450 has increased to ₹2.51 lakh, while the ex-showroom price of its most expensive top variant has now reached ₹2.74 lakh.
Powerful 452 cc engine and features remain intact
Despite the increase in prices, there has been no change in the performance profile of the vehicle. This motorcycle has the company’s modern 452 cc capacity liquid-cooled single-cylinder Sherpa engine. This engine generates power of 39 BHP and peak torque of 40 Newton Meter (Nm), which comes with 6-speed gearbox. As features, it will still have a 5-inch round TFT display, smartphone connectivity, turn-by-turn navigation and riding modes.
